  • This paper analyzes the impact of the Canada-Korea Free Trade Agreement on the basis of the published text and agreed schedule of commitments. We find that the Agreement reinforces existing patterns of comparative advantage between Canada (agriculture and resource-based sectors) and Korea (autos and other industries). The sensitive sectors that held up the deal for years - autos into Canada and beef into Korea - witness major trade gains, but are not unduly disrupted. In both economies, the major output gains otherwise come in non-traded services sectors, driven by income effects. We find that trade diversion effects are quite significant; this lends support for the domino theory of major free trade agreements - since the Korea-EU agreement broke the ice, the pressure has intensified on third parties to re-level playing fields by striking their own deals. The study breaks new ground in modelling services trade by developing policy impacts based on the extent to which the text of the Agreement modifies Korea's and Canada's scores on the OECD's Services Trade Restrictiveness Index and by providing estimates of Mode 3 Services trade impacts. The analysis of the Agreement as negotiated, the present study, in our view, is a step forward in understanding the impact of modern free trade agreements.

  • This study analyzes the impacts of agricultural water shortages in Korea using a combined top-down and bottom-up model. A multi-region multi-output agricultural sector model with detailed descriptions of production technologies and water and land resource constraints has been combined with a standard CGE model. The impacts of four different water shortage scenarios were simulated. It is shown that an active adaptation of crop choices occurs in even the regions with relatively abundant water resources in order to respond to the change in relative output prices caused by water shortages. We found that although the losses in production values are not quite large despite water shortages due to the price feedbacks, the loss in GDP is substantial. We show that our combined approach has advantages in deriving region and product specific production effects as well as the overall GDP loss effect of water shortages.

  • This study aims to estimate the economic effect of Korea's transition to a developed country in WTO negotiations. If Korea develops into an advanced country, it must give up many advantages in the agricultural sector. In particular, limiting the scope of sensitive items, giving up the selection of special items, and drastic tariff reductions are expected to have greater negative effects on the agricultural sector. According to research results, Korea's GDP rose slightly from 0.2 to 0.8 percent following the DDA settlement. Especially when China is classified as an advanced country along with Korea, Korea's GDP appears to be growing even more. On the other hand, damage is expected in most areas of agriculture. The trade deficit in the agriculture sector is expected to widen as output in the agricultural sector decreases, and import growth exceeds export growth. In the non-agricultural sector, there are no significant differences in the change in WTO status. However, if China is grouped together as an advanced country, the export growth rate of the Korean manufacturing industry appears greater.

  • Purpose - The purpose of this study is to evaluate the economic effects of FTAs using the concept of value-added exports. So far, the economic effects of FTAs have been dependent on decrease in import prices due to tariff cuts in importing countries, but the actual tariff reduction need to consider the value added of the exporting countries. Design/methodology - Value-added export refers to the added value created in the exporting country out of total exports. Among value-added exports, direct value-added export is interpreted as the Regional Value Contents (RVC), from which the economic effect of the FTA can be analyzed. A modified GTAP-VA model takes into account RVC in order to estimate accurate effects of FTAs. Findings - By the re-evaluation of the FTA based on the RVC, this paper makes it clear that the economic effects of the existing FTA methodology have the possibility of overestimation. In addition, as a new FTA with a strengthened Rules of Origin (ROO) is being initiated, a negative impact on international trade and GVC utilization may occur. Originality/value - This study introduces the concept of value-added export in analyzing the effects of FTAs. The new analysis methodology of this paper emphasizes the importance of value-added exports. Re-organization of GVCs would change regional trade agreements and empower ROO by weakening existing GVCs and transforming the value chain from global into regional scope.

  • In this study, I focus on analyzing how the effects of implementing ETS are different depending on whether Korean ETS linking with carbon markets in other countries. The global computable general equilibrium (CGE) model built in this study analyzes the chages in the production and trade of industrial sectors according to the international linkage of ETS compared to the reference scenario of emissions reduction targets and implementation of ETS. From the analysis of internatioanl linkage of carbon markets scenarios, Annex B countries-South Korea carbon market linkage with individual ETS in China worse the economic outcomes in South Korea the most. This means South Korea lose the international competitiveness compared to China in this scenario. On the other hand, Annex B-China carbon market linkage with Korean individual ETS implementation reduce the decreases in production and trading. The most effective way is to join a global emissions trading market with China. The results are consistent in most industries of South Korea. These results are caused by that the supply of emission allowance is increased and the price of emissions allowances is dropped by China's participation to the carbon market, which can be understood to reduce the carbon reduction cost for industrial sectors. In addition, it can be also concluded that the determinant of the negative impact of ETS on changes in production and trade is more sensitive to the price of emissions allowances than to the characteristics of production and trade structure.

  • Functional compounds including flavonoids, anthocyanins, polyphneols and antioxidants were extracted from blue honeysuckle (Lonicera caerulea L.) using highly efficient microwave-assisted extraction. And extraction process was modeled and optimized according to response surface methodology (RSM). The independent variables ($X_n$) were ethanol concentration ($X_1$: 0, 25, 50, 75, 100%), irradiation time ($X_2$: 1, 3, 5, 7, 9 min), and microwave power ($X_3$: 60, 120, 180, 240, 300 W). Dependent variables ($Y_n$) were total flavonoid contents ($Y_1$), total anthocyanin contents ($Y_2$), total polyphenol contents ($Y_3$) and antioxidant activity ($Y_4$). Four-dimensional response surface plots were generated based on the fitted second-order polynomial models to get optimal conditions. Estimated optimal conditions for 4 responses were ethanol concentration of 54-72%, irradiation time of 7.1-7.6 min, and microwave power of 243-251 W. Ridge analysis predicted the maximal responses of total flavonoid content, total anthocyanin content, total polyphenol content and antioxidant activity were 38.00 mg RE/g, 6.80 mg CGE/g, 14.90 mg GAE/g, 89.10%, respectively. Verification experiment was carried out at predicted optimal conditions and experimental values for total flavonoid content, total anthocyanin content, total polyphenol content and antioxidant activity were 38.10 mg RE/g, 6.72 mg CGE/g, 14.91 mg GAE/g and 89.13%, respectively. No significant difference was observed between predicted and experimental values, indicating good fitness of fitted model and successful application of RSM.

  • This study analyzes the economic effect through the use of the RCEP direct transport rules, and suggests the necessacity of logistics efficiency and policy alternatives. The advantage of the hub network has been widely applied to the international logistics system, but there is a limit in the FTA logistics system in which goods must be directly transported between two contracting parties. Therefore, based on the new RCEP direct transport rules and the theoretical review on the possibility of an FTA logistics hub, FTA logistics efficiency improvement is estimated. This study quantitatively estimated the economic effect of direct transportation, unlike the previous studies, which were limited to the analysis of judicial precedents or surveys. GTAP model was used through five scenarios according to the impact of the RCEP tariff cut and the FTA logistics hub establishment in Singapore or Korea. As a result of the analysis, Korea's trade volume increased by 0.38% of exports and 1.63% of imports, and RCEP would increase exports by 0.27% and imports by 0.42%. In particular, the establishment of an FTA logistics hub (0.71%) was found to have a greater effect on the improvement of terms of trade than a tariff cut (0.12%), confirming the necessity of establishing an FTA logistics hub in RCEP. As a policy proposal, the institutional support of the customs authorities for the use of RCEP, the expansion of the free trade area where BWT traded cargo can be stored, and the establishment of a system for issuing back-to-back certificates of origin with approved exporters.

  • This research first reviewed and analysed the current domestic situation of the voluntary agreement implementation and then it developed the policy implementation scenarios which will be applied to the model, KORTEM_ V.2. The model, consisted with 83 industries and commodities, examined the economic and environmental impacts of this policy instrument. Depending on the efforts of participating sectors and agents for fuel substitution and energy efficiency improvement, it has been evaluated that the voluntary agreement could be the "no-regret" policy. In other words, if the participating sectors and agents can achieve the voluntary energy conservation and emission reduction target without the negative impact on output level, the reduction of national emission will be achieved by creating the economic benefit, simultaneously. Therefore, for the successful implementation of voluntary agreement, this study emphasized the importance of expansion and strengthening of the current financial and institutional support for participating sectors and agents.

  • This paper is concerned with the effect of an increase in the import price of LNG on the Korean economy and industries. A computable general equilibrium analysis is applied to compute the comparative-statical effect of 10% rise of LNG price. The price increase places relatively heavy burden on the city gas, oil products and thermal power, decreasing their outputs and domestic sales by relatively larger percentages than other industries. The 10% increase in the LNG price reduces GDP by 0.4% and raises the general price level by 0.08%. The increase in oil price resulting in the same decreasing rate of GDP caused by the 10% LNG price rise turns out to raise the general price level and reduce the consumer's welfare in terms of equivalent variation by less percentage than the increase in LNG price.

  • This paper compares the economic effects of climate policy options in Korea. The impacts and implications of carbon and Btu tax schemes are analyzed using the META Net modeling system, which was developed at the Lawrence Livermore National Laboratory (LLNL). Findings indicate that carbon tax is more cost effective compared to Btu tax, but this does not necessarily mean the former is more desirable than the latter. Energy market stability and national energy security is equally important in choosing policy options. Moreover Btu tax is more effective in reducing energy consumption in general. It reduces not only carbon intensive energy sources, but non-fossil fuel like electricity. Korean economy consumes too much energy and energy efficiency is very low compared to other OECD countries. So the reduction of energy demand growth should be the first priority of the national energy policy in Korea.
